When Vicki was 50 years old, she decided to go back to school and became a certified nursing assistant from which she retired. Prior to her illness she enjoyed being with her family for those big family dinners and you knew not to be there, or she would call and ask “Where are you?” She really enjoyed dancing having worked with Fred Astaire and Arthur Murray Dance Studios in Tidewater, VA. Vicki also like watching "Dancing with the Stars."
Born January 14, 1947 in Dayton, OH, she was the daughter of the late Charles H. Jackson (Deceased) and Dorothy M. Campbell-Jackson (Deceased). In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her brother, Jerry Jackson (Deceased).
Left to cherish her memory are her loving and devoted daughter, Nicole Jennings-Tsipliareles & husband Demetrios Tsipliareles of Pipestem, Stephanie Maderazo, Joel Grigg & wife Lisa Grigg, and Brandon Grigg all of Virginia Beach, VA; a sister, Sandra Jackson-Martin of Dalton, GA; five grandchildren, Rueben, Giovanni, George, Brandon and Adrian all of Virginia Beach; three great-grandchildren, Ava, Aiden and Riley; and several nieces and nephews.
The family has honored Vicki’s request that she be donated to the WV School of Osteopathic Medicine in Lewisburg. A service of remembrance will be held at a later date. The Jennings family is being served by the Memorial Funeral Directory and Cremation Center on the Athens Road in Princeton.
